One Pot Pasta with Fresh Tomatoes, Feta, and Fresh Basil

Prep Time: 10 mins
Cook Time: 15 mins
Total Time: 25 mins
Cuisine: Italian
Serves: 4 servings

Ingredients

  1. 8 oz pasta
  2. 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
  3. 1 cup feta cheese, crumbled
  4. 1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ped
  5. 2 cloves garlic, minced
  6. 2 tablespoons olive oil
  7.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Fill a large, wide skillet or pasta pot with 4 cups of water, ensuring there's enough room for the pasta to cook evenly.
  2. Add olive oil to the pot and heat over medium-high heat. Sauté minced garlic for 30-45 seconds until fragrant, being careful not to burn.
  3. Add pasta and halved cherry tomatoes to the pot. Pour in enough water to just cover the ingredients, approximately 3-4 cups.
  4. Bring the mixture to a rolling boil, then reduce heat to medium. Stir occasionally to prevent pasta from sticking and ensure even cooking.
  5. Cook for 8-10 minutes, stirring frequently, until pasta is al dente and most liquid has been absorbed. The tomatoes should begin to break down and create a light sauce.
  6. Remove from heat and let sit for 2-3 minutes to allow remaining liquid to be absorbed and sauce to thicken.
  7. Gently fold in crumbled feta cheese, allowing it to slightly melt from the residual heat.
  8. Season with sal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ste.
  9. Garnish with freshly chopped basil leaves just before serving.
  10. Serve immediately in warm bowls, ensuring each portion has a generous mix of pasta, tomatoes, feta, and basil.

Tips

  1. Choose the Right Pan: Use a large, wide skillet to ensure even cooking and proper liquid absorption.
  2. Fresh is Best: Use ripe, in-season cherry tomatoes for the most intense flavor and natural sweetness.
  3. Timing is Crucial: Watch your pasta closely during cooking. The key is to achieve al dente texture while creating a light, silky sauce.
  4. Don't Overcrowd: Ensure pasta and tomatoes have enough room to move and cook evenly.
  5. Feta Finishing: Add feta at the end to prevent it from completely melting, maintaining its creamy texture.
  6. Basil Brilliance: Chop basil just before serving to preserve its bright, fresh aroma.
  7. Season Gradually: Taste and adjust salt and pepper as you cook for perfectly balanced flavor.Pro Tip: This recipe is incredibly forgiving and adaptable - feel free to add protein like grilled chicken or experiment with different herbs!

Nutrition Facts

Calories: 380kcal

Carbohydrates: 45g

Protein: 15g

Fat: 18g

Saturated Fat: 7g

Cholesterol: 30mg
